Salmon with lemon butter sauce

Ingredients

  • 30g butter
  • 2 tbs plain flour
  • 1 garlic clove, crushed
  • 2 cups (500ml) fish stock
  • 2 tsp lemon juice
  • 1 tbs olive oil
  • 4 Coles Australian Salmon Skin Off Portions
  • 1 lemon, thinly sliced
  • Steamed baby broccoli, to serve
  • Steamed green beans, to serve

Method

  1. Step 1

    Melt the but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at until it begins to foam. Add the flour and garlic. Cook, stirring, for 1 min or until the mixture is bubbling. Remove from heat. Gradually add the stock, whisking to combine. Return to medium heat. Bring to a simmer. Cook, stirring occasionally, for 15 mins or until the mixture reduces by half and thickens. Remove from heat. Strain the mixture into a jug and stir in the lemon juice. Cover to keep warm.
  2. Step 2

    Meanwhile, heat the oil in a large frying pan over medium heat. Add the salmon and cook for 2-3 mins each side for medium or until cooked to your liking. Transfer to a plate. Cook the lemon slices in the pan for 1-2 mins each side or until caramelised.
  3. Step 3

    Divide the salmon among serving plates. Drizzle salmon with the lemon butter sauce and serve with lemon slices, baby broccoli and beans.
